Palaioskamia
Palaioskamia is a hamlet in Municipality of Arta, Epirus and has about 36 residents. Palaioskamia is situated nearby to the village Vigla, as well as near Polydroso.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Vigla
Village
Vigla is a village in the Arta regional unit of Greece, located on the northern shore of the Ambracian Gulf. It is split into two neighborhoods, Palaia Vigla and Nea Vigla.
